Journal Comment résoudre la "crise du logiciel" ?

Posté par  (site web personnel) .
Étiquettes : aucune
0
22
sept.
2005
L'évolution de la puissance de calcul couplée à la baisse du prix des équipements informatique et sa généralisation n'a que peu changé une constatation faite il y a plus de 30 ans : il y a une difficulté intrinsèque à estimer correctement l’effort requis et la fiabilité du résultat de l’activité de production de logiciel, les développeurs et utilisateurs sont sans cesse confrontés aux erreurs graves de sous-estimation des coûts et des délais, ainsi que des risques, des projets de (…)

Journal GCC et le mmx/sse{1,2,3)/3dnow

Posté par  (site web personnel) .
Étiquettes : aucune
0
2
oct.
2005
Nos processeurs modernes sont formidables et sont capable de nous proposer des merveilles comme 4 multiplicationss flotantes en un cycle.
Je veux parler des fpu MMX/SSE/3dnow

Je me suis dit, Gcc doit bien gérer ça (?)

Je me suis donc amusé à générer un petit code c

#include <stdio.h>


int main (void)
{
float a1,b1,c1,a2,b2,c2,z,y,x;
int i;

for (i= 45 ; i< 789 ; i++ ) if (i % 119) a1 = (float)i+75;

a2 = a1+56.456;
b1 = a2 + (…)

Journal Alliance Sun - Google

Posté par  (site web personnel) .
Étiquettes :
0
5
oct.
2005
Une dépêche tombera, mais annonçons d'ors et déjà l'alliance afin d'étoffer l'offre de services des deux entreprises.
Google apporte Gmail, Google Talk ou encore Desktop Search et Sun apporte Java et OpenOffice.

A suivre en attendant les dépêches, quelques liens :

http://www.zdnet.fr/actualites/internet/0,39020774,39271933,00.htm(...)
http://www.vnunet.fr/actualite/tpepme_-_business/strategies_et_marc(...)

La vidéo de la présentation (s'accrocher avec l'américain pour les non habitués...)
conjointe google - Sun
http://www.sun.com/2005-1004/feature/index.html(...)

Journal Repenser les langages et le développement logiciel

Posté par  (site web personnel) .
Étiquettes : aucune
0
7
oct.
2005
Chers tous, j'aimerai vous présenter deux réflexions très profondes qui tentent de remettre en perspective notre façon d'écrire des logiciels, d'architecturer ceux-ci et bien sûr de repenser totalement les langages de programmation.
Cette remise en cause émerge face à l'importance des bugs dans l'industrie logicielle.

Jaron Lanier[1], pionnier de la réalité virtuelle et Victoria Livschitz[2], "senior IT architect", tentent d'analyser les causes du facteur bug dans le développement logiciel.

[1]http://java.sun.com/features/2003/01/lanier_qa1.html(...)

[2]http://java.sun.com/developer/technicalArticles/Interviews/livschit(...)


Je vous les traduis ici en le (…)

Journal Spécifier une nouvelle librairie graphique

Posté par  (site web personnel) .
Étiquettes : aucune
0
20
juin
2005
Bonjour, je commence à réfléchir à la conception d'une librairie graphique en lisaac ( http://fr.wikipedia.org/wiki/Lisaac(...) ). L'ambition de cette librairie est de couvrir tous les services apportés par SDL+ OpenGL+OpenAL ou encore DirectX.

Ma volonté première est d'aller vers un maximum de simplicité, de confort d'utilisation, mais surtout de doter ce langage d'une librairie graphique/jeu. Je ne suis pas attiré par recopier bêtement une librairie. Dans l'esprit OpenSource, je préfèrerai demander aux développeurs ce qu'ils aimeraient utiliser.

Lisaac étant un (…)

Journal Logiciel générant automatiquement le graphe d'un code source

Posté par  (site web personnel) .
Étiquettes : aucune
0
17
juin
2004
... en C de préférence, mais sur un autre langage ça me va aussi.
(C'est pour des statistiques).

J'avais trouvé un truc qui s'interfaçait sur GCC, mais il faut patcher, etc...
J'ai trouvé aussi : http://www.grammatech.com/products/codesurfer/overview.html(...)
mais c'est payant :(
On peut en trouver plein (http://grok2.tripod.com/code_comprehension.html(...)) mais savoir lequel choisir.

Avez-vous eu à choisir parmi, ceux-ci, lesquels choisir, etc...

Connaissez vous un programme simple qui me génère un graphe ou tout au moins de quoi en générer ?

(…)

Journal Documentation sur le wrapper du driver nvidia

Posté par  (site web personnel) .
Étiquettes : aucune
0
24
juin
2004
Bonjour, le driver proprio nvidia pour linux est un driver maison muni d'un wrapper sur un binaire.
Je suppose donc que ce binaire est utilisable pour un autre OS que linux...

Quand on survole les fichier C on se rend bien compte qu'il y a une interface pour le noyau

cf ce commentaire dans nv.c

/* nv_kern_ functions, interfaces used by linux kernel */

Google est pas gentil, il ne veut pas cracher de docs sur comment utiliser ce wrapper (…)

Journal Automatisation de patching de sécurité

Posté par  (site web personnel) .
Étiquettes : aucune
0
16
juil.
2004
Juste une petite idée en passant : pourquoi ne pas créer une SSLL qui aurai pour mission de centraliser toutes les configs noyaux (et le reste) de ses clients et de leur envoyer des patchs binaires personnalisés lorsqu'une faille est découverte ?

Cette SSLL pourrait offrir ses services à des SSII dont ce n'est pas la spécialité

Parce que le problème, tel que je le vois de mon nuage, est de devoir recompiler le noyau à chaque découverte de patch.


(…)

Journal Licence logiciel et viabilité du modèle économique

Posté par  (site web personnel) .
Étiquettes : aucune
0
6
sept.
2004
Cher journal, le modèle économique du libre, voir exposé de R. Viseur, est économiquement précairement viable pour un créateur ou un groupe de créateur.
Il appelle à la notion de service alors qu'un logiciel nécessite un gros investissement de départ pour un groupe de personnes ou une institution. Le service peut-être fortement rémunérateur, mais une entreprise préferera l'indépendance, en règle général.
On peut troller à l'envi sur ces points en fonction de son expérience.

Je suis assez attiré philosophiquement par (…)

Journal La constitution européene

Posté par  (site web personnel) .
Étiquettes : aucune
0
9
sept.
2004
Après avoir lu "La voie humaine, une nouvelle sociale-démocratie" de Jacques attali, je me pose de nouveau quelques questions.

Lisons-là cette constitution, elle fait 300 pages, mais on peut se concentrer sur quelques passages interressant :
( http://www.diplomatie.fr/europe/pdf/constitution.pdf(...) )

1. Les États membres aménagent les monopoles nationaux présentant un caractère commercial,
de telle façon que soit assurée, dans les conditions d'approvisionnement et de débouchés, l'exclusion
de toute discrimination entre les ressortissants des États membres.

Le présent article s'applique à tout (…)

Journal Microsoft vaincra

Posté par  (site web personnel) .
Étiquettes : aucune
0
18
mar.
2005
Essayons d'analyser le problème le plus objectivement possible.

Pour cela, je vais essayer d'analyser les forces en présence, en l'intégrant avec les besoins des entreprises. Je travaille dans une PME full windows, et, en formation, je questionne inlassablement mes profs, chefs de projets bonhommes dotés de 20-25 ans de métier. Je ne connais personne de plus objectif qu'eux. La guerre Microsoft/Linux, il s'en fichent éperdument. Ils tentent de choisir leur technos le plus objectivement possible en bon chefs de projet, (…)

Journal Les (vieux) automates de la SNCF tournent sous...

Posté par  (site web personnel) .
Étiquettes : aucune
0
5
avr.
2005
OS/2 !

L'autre jour, alors que je tappai sur l'écran des vieux terminaux destinés aux réservations en tout genre, en espérant qu'il me sélectionne l'horaire désiré, je balaie les côté de l'écran tactil. L'écran se brouille, la machine reboot.

Démarrage du bios, 16 Mo de mémoire. Vu l'âge de la bête, ça doit être un 486, ou un pentium, mais rien là dessus.

Et là je vois le démarrage... Microsoft Operating System/2, 1991

J'avoue que je suis pas sûr d'avoir (…)

Journal Meeting militant pour le oui

Posté par  (site web personnel) .
Étiquettes : aucune
0
13
avr.
2005
Hier soir, palais des congrès Nantais, grande réalisation de son maire actuel, se tenait un "meeting" du Parti Socialiste pour le Oui avec Dominique Strauss-Khan en guest-star.
Je suis arrivé légèrement retard, en plein discours enflammé de "Jean-Marc" Ayrault. J'ai entrepris d'observer pour vous la mise en scène.

La scène justement était partagé par des jeunes militant, ci-devant les potiches, alternativement peint en rouge et blanc, assis sur des chaises de fortunes, en deux rang inclinés de 30 degrés par (…)